Rocket-launcher attack on Fla. police department thwarted - NY Daily News

Authorities say a plot to attack a central Florida police department with a rocket launcher has been foiled, just days before the onslaught was slated to go down.


Monday's planned attack on the Eustis Police Department was thwarted after the arrest of two men and discovery of more than 20 weapons, drugs and bullet proof vests in a shed, the Marion County Sheriff's Office said Monday.


Authorities credited Saturday's arrests to a tip about a rocket-propelled grenade launcher being stored inside a shed.


Capt. James Pogue said a search of that shed recovered 22 firearms, containers of black powder, more than a pound of marijuana, both powdered and crack cocaine, prescription pills, scales, two bulletproof vests and other drugs, the Orlando Sentinel reported.


Eustis Police Chief Fred Cobb was alerted to the plotted attack on Friday and described himself as "blindsided" by its news, MyNews13 reported.


The following day Christopher Conger, 32, and Jeremy Robertson, 29, were arrested and hit with a number of charges. Those include possession of cocaine with intent to sell, grand theft of a firearm, using or displaying a firearm during a felony and wearing a bulletproof vest during certain offenses.
